Dermatomycoses
- Caused by dermatophytes or yeasts.
- For example, foot and hand fungi (Tinea pedis, Tinea manuum), fungal infections of the skin surface and skin folds (Tinea corporis and Tinea cruris), Pityriasis versicolor and skin candidiasis.

What Lamisil Cream contains
The active ingredient is terbinafine hydrochloride. 1g of cream contains 10mg of this active ingredient.
The other ingredients are: sodium hydroxide, benzyl alcohol, sorbitan monostearate, cetyl palmitate, cetyl alcohol, stearyl alcohol, monostearyl polysorbitan, isopropyl myristate, and purified water. See section 2 "Lamisil Cream contains cetyl and stearyl alcohol, and benzyl alcohol".
Lamisil cream must not be used,
if you are allergic to terbinafine hydrochloride or any of the other ingredients of this medicine listed in section 6.
